InDesign has added more and more graphic capabilities to its page layout features. If you are an Illustrator user, you’ll find the drawing tools are very similar, though more limited. If you are a Photoshop user, you’ll be pleased to see how quickly you can pop into Photoshop from InDesign to adjust your images.
